JEAN-JOSEPH-GEORGES DEYMIER

Born : February 13, 1886
Deceased : April 2, 1956

Apostolic Vicar of Hangzhou, 1937-1946; Titular Bishop of Diospolis in Thracia
Archbishop of Hangzhou, 1946-1956
